What is the meaning of a deceased's body not decomposing fifteen years after their death, and is it permissible to bury a new deceased next to an old one in the same grave?
Source: FtawySummarized from the full answer at Ftawy · imported Sep 2, 2026
The earth does not consume the bodies of prophets, due to the saying of the Prophet, may Allah’s prayers and peace be upon him: "Indeed, Allah, the Almighty and Majestic, has forbidden the earth from consuming the bodies of the prophets, peace be upon them."
As for those other than prophets, this has not been established concerning them. If the body of one of them does not decompose, this can be considered a karamah (a miraculous favor), but it remains among the matters of the unseen that cannot be asserted definitively except with evidence.
It is not permissible to bury two or more persons in one grave except out of necessity.
